About Gem Aromatics Gem Aromatics is a leading manufacturer and exporter of fragrance compounds, essential oils, aroma chemicals, and natural isolates. With production facilities across India and clients in over 50 countries, Gem Aromatics combines cutting-edge R&D, modern manufacturing, and global regulatory compliance to deliver high-quality aromatic solutions to the flavor, fragrance, and personal care industries. Role Overview We are seeking a dynamic Chartered Accountant (CA) to work directly with the Managing Director and CFO , supporting both financial operations and executive-level coordination. This dual role requires a blend of analytical finance expertise, business acumen, and administrative precision, with opportunities for cross-functional and international exposure. Key ResponsibilitiesFinance & Accounting: Oversee daily accounting and financial operations across group entities. Prepare monthly MIS, variance analysis, cash flow forecasts, and financial dashboards for leadership review. Ensure timely filing of GST, TDS, income tax returns, and ROC compliance. Assist with annual audit coordination (Statutory, Internal, GST), liaising with auditors and consultants. Support costing and pricing models for fragrance compounds and essential oils. Monitor inventory valuation and cost optimization across manufacturing sites. Contribute to financial planning for capital expenditures, export growth, and expansion projects. Provide financial due diligence and investment analysis for new business opportunities. Executive Assistance (to MD/CFO): Manage calendars, internal and external meeting coordination, follow-ups, and travel plans. Draft reports, investor decks, board presentations, and confidential communications. Track and prioritize action items from leadership meetings; ensure timely execution. Interface with senior-level customers, suppliers, and strategic partners when required. Manage sensitive documents including contracts, NDAs, and government filings. Business Strategy & Operations Support: Support MD/CFO in analyzing operational KPIs across units (production efficiency, export revenue, margin tracking). Assist with implementation and monitoring of ERP systems (e.g., SAP, TallyPrime, etc.). Prepare regulatory compliance reports including REACH, IFRA, and other international documentation required for exports. Identify and support cost-saving initiatives across departments. Coordinate with cross-functional teams: R&D, logistics, international sales, procurement. Candidate ProfileEducation & Experience: Qualified Chartered Accountant (1–5 years of post-qualification experience). Prior experience in manufacturing, export-oriented units , or chemical / aroma industry preferred. Exposure to global compliance and multi-currency accounting is an added advantage. Technical Skills: Strong command over Indian Accounting Standards , Direct & Indirect Taxation , Export Incentives (RoDTEP, MEIS, etc.). Proficiency in Excel , PowerPoint , ERP platforms , and financial modeling . Understanding of cost accounting , product costing , and inventory control . Soft Skills: Highly organized with strong attention to detail. Discreet, with the ability to handle confidential information. Excellent written and verbal communication skills. Proactive, self-driven, and able to manage multiple priorities. Strategic thinker with strong analytical ability.
